The High RTP: Player-Focused Design
With an impressive Return to Player (RTP) rate of 98%, Chickenroad stands out as a game committed to fairness and player satisfaction. RTP represents the percentage of all wagered money that is returned to players over an extended period. A 98% RTP indicates that, on average, players can expect to receive 98 cents back for every dollar wagered. This exceptionally high RTP makes Chickenroad a more attractive option for players seeking a game with favorable odds. It also showcases InOut Games‘ dedication to providing a transparent and rewarding gaming experience. This aspect alone contributing to its growing popularity.
